usb: Add QOM property "attached".
USB devices in attached state are visible to the guest. This patch adds a QOM property for this. Write access is opt-in per device. Some devices manage attached state automatically (usb-host, usb-serial, usb-redir), so we can't enable write access universally but have to do it on a case by case base. So far, no device opts in.
